Why Vitamin C Works for Dark Spots

Vitamin C is more than just an antioxidant—it’s the powerhouse ingredient for tackling hyperpigmentation and brightening dull skin tones effectively. Here’s why:

1. Fades Pigmentation: It interrupts melanin production by inhibiting tyrosinase (an enzyme responsible for dark spots).

2. Boosts Collagen: Promotes firmer, smoother skin by stimulating collagen synthesis—a bonus effect many people overlook!

3. Protects Against Damage: Shields your skin from free radicals caused by pollution or UV rays, preventing future discoloration before it starts.

But here’s where it gets tricky: not all Vitamin C serums are created equal. Some oxidize too fast (losing potency), while others irritate sensitive skin with overly strong formulas.

2. The Ordinary Ascorbic Acid + Alpha Arbutin ($12 USD)

If hyperpigmentation is your main concern, this serum packs double the punch with alpha arbutin—a known melanin inhibitor combined with ascorbic acid at high potency levels (8%). During testing on darker patches near my jawline, results were noticeable within four weeks—but expect mild tingling if your skin isn’t used to actives yet.

Key takeaway: Ideal for stubborn dark spots but requires patience with layering routines.
